If you are actively playing, or want to try to keep up on plot, or jump in with a little bit of background and stuff from the forums before you do,
the Arabel Diaries,
https://nodebb.cityofarabel.com/category/10/the-arabel-diaries
and the IC Discussion (IN CHARACTER discussion, ie one of your characters talking to another player's character usually)
https://nodebb.cityofarabel.com/category/60/ic-discussion
are important threads; in particular, people may be sending MESSAGES TO YOUR CHARACTER(S) and/or responding to YOUR MESSAGES this way, about in game actions, plots, and activities, so if you are actively playing, you might want to scan this forum regularly for your characters names (you can do this with searches as well). This forum has tag functions, so it is possible you will get notified when someone tags you in a message, which may simplify things if you are busy/ away.
I find if I log in every few days/ week or two (at least if the server isn't too busy), if I browse the 'recent' posts, I can sometimes scroll back to the last time I read any messages, scan through the new messages, open a thread or two that seems important or that I'm interested in, etc.
Once I've scanned through most of what I feel like I have time or interest for, or bookmarked, ones that seem important buy I don't have time to read for later, I usually jump to the "Unread" messages (if I'm logged in) and clear all the unread messages, so it will give me a sense of how many new messages have popped up in the forums I have access to since I was last logged in and to a look through.
Just a heads up: if you are ACTIVELY PLAYING, and there is a fair amount going on in game, a fair number of players in game, there may be a LOT more IN CHARACTER messages to read, sometimes long, sometimes not well edited or clear etc lol, maybe 1-3 more hours per weeks of stuff that might be relevant to you and your characters (I'm just estimating, I didn't really log or run any numbers: others might be able to provide a much better estimate). But it is possible that it will MORE THAN DOUBLE the amount of time you may be spending in the forums, etc.
